Output 901ca8976b26785d2d50663c98a83c824c274f5d7756a7dc0e563dce9a2a1044:1

value
161226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c8bb76014f34d0773b08d07b91e136607d19aed OP_EQUAL
address
3A8MTrLrh1fwRKMDsyv5ov9QXzsZgaFXD4
transaction
901ca8976b26785d2d50663c98a83c824c274f5d7756a7dc0e563dce9a2a1044
spent
true